#485af4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#485af4 is composed of 28.2% red, 35.3%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.5% cyan, 63.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 233.7 degrees, a saturation of 88.7% and a lightness of 62%. #485af4 color hex could be obtained by blending #90b4ff with #0000e9.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

Shades and Tints of #485af4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#eff0f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#485af4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9a9ba2 is the less saturated color, while #4154fb is the most saturated one.
